Oh, and don't worry if the drying time is longer than two weeks. Unless your car is out baking in the sun, it will take longer for all the little bubbles/clouds to disappear since the H.O. film is so thick. I think it took about 5-6 weeks for my tint to dry (since it's garaged 99% of the day).
